The best 3 wheel stroller with car seat jogging stollers have three or four large air-filled wheels that can take on any terrain. They are much easier to maneuver than strollers with the smaller plastic wheels. They may feel like you are pushing a brick when you run over stones or turn around.

Many strollers that jog have either a fixed or swivel front wheel. While a swivel wheel can be useful for maneuvering, it's not safe to use while running as it can cause the stroller's wheels to abruptly shift direction and possibly crash. The best 3 wheel stroller joggers come with a lockable front wheel that can be repositioned to a fixed position to run in.

Check with your pediatrician prior to letting your child ride in a stroller. They can help you determine whether your child has the neck and core strength to take on the stress of running with their stroller. They can also provide tips on the weight limits and safety features of your stroller.

If you're planning to take your child out for a walk, it's important to look for a stroller with padding for the harness and a 5-point safety harness. A 5-point safety harness keeps your child safely secured in the seat and prevents them from climbing out of the seat or falling out of the back which could pose a risk for both you and your child. A padded harness cushions the impact of falls, which reduces the risk of sustaining head injuries.

Comfort

The top jogger strollers come with numerous features that make them more comfortable for the baby and the runner. They have a good suspension that cushions bumps and jolts. They also have adjustable tracking to keep the front wheel straight for long distances. Hand brakes that are mounted on handlebars enable runners to better control speed and direction. They usually have a larger canopy that shields the child from sun and headwinds and usually have a peek-a-boo window to allow the runner to easily check on the baby without stopping.

One aspect that is more important than the type of front wheel or its swivel ability in our opinion is the ability to alter the track so that the stroller runs straight on flat surfaces and over long distances. Strollers with no this feature tend to veer and require constant manual correction. This can quickly increase and become exhausting during a run.

A cushioned seat can be a nice touch to make joggers more comfortable for babies, especially if it has extra padding on the crotch or shoulder areas. Based on the child this could be a great way to keep them content during a run and keep them from yawning or fidgeting, which can distract you and affect your pace.

Most joggers carry a bag for storage which is helpful for carrying gear and supplies. Some also have a cup holder that is great for snacks and drinks. We have found that, based on our experience, most joggers fold relatively flat, which makes them easier to carry and store in the trunk of an automobile.

Another crucial aspect to consider is whether or not a particular jogger will fit your child's requirements, specifically their height. The majority of joggers are designed to accommodate children of up to 50 pounds, and they can be used in conjunction with an infant car seat for those planning to use them as their primary stroller. If you're looking for a stroller to endure multiple births and children, you might think about a convertible model that can expand with your child.

A braking system that is operated by hand similar to a bicycle brake, is a vital feature to look out for in a stroller. This allows you to stop and slow down easily which is particularly useful when running downhill. Another excellent safety feature to look for is a five-point harness that includes shoulder straps, a waist belt and a crotch belt that connect to keep your child safe.

Another consideration is whether you'd like a jogger with fixed or the front wheels that swivel. Fixed-wheel joggers are more easy to steer than swivel ones but swivel joggers can be difficult to maneuver on bumpy terrain. You should also consider whether you'll use a stroller car seat along with your jogger and, if so, what type of infant car seat. Certain joggers work with many car seats, whereas others only accept a few models.
